Construction Updates at Commack and Nesconset!

The lower walls are completed and the steel work is in place for the main floor of the Commack Branch Children's Department. Concrete will be poured in a few days.
Here is another view of the Commack Branch's Children's Department!



On to Nesconset...


The Nesconset Branch continues to take shape! Here are some of the new electrical lines that are being installed throughout the main level.

The new elevator shaft nears completion.

The future main entrance to the building. The two side doorways are being converted to large windows. This room will be the main reference area.

Brick work almost complete in the area where the old garage bay doors once were. This section of the building will become the new Children's Department and meeting room.

Nesconset Roof Takes Shape!


The corrugated steel roof has been placed on the Nesconset building. The next step is to remove the steel sections for the new skylights. The final roof will then be installed.


Workers construct the walls for the future elevator.



On the Smithtown Blvd. side of the building, construction workers install the framework for the concrete footings on which the new brickwork will be placed. This is the former location of the main door to the old Armory.



This is the outside wall of the future Children's Department and public meeting room.
